One of several central characteristics on the Mexican labeling system could be the implementation of Food items WARNING LABELS IN MEXICO. These labels are A part of a broader general public well being initiative to handle climbing obesity and diabetes rates in the inhabitants. The front-of-bundle labeling in Mexico (also generally known as Front of Pack Labeling Mexico or Front-of-pack Diet Warning Labels in Mexico) mandates the inclusion of black octagonal warning symptoms to the entrance of meals packaging. These warnings alert individuals if a product is higher in energy, sugar, sodium, saturated fat, or consists of caffeine or sweeteners that ought to be avoided by kids. This Mexican entrance-of-pack labeling reform was formally rolled out in phases, beginning in Oct 2020, and signifies a big change in how nutritional information is introduced.

Mexican labeling specifications also need complete information around the packaging. The overall labeling of goods in Mexico will have to involve the item name, component list, Internet articles, manufacturer facts, nation of origin, expiration day, and storage Guidelines. All this should be presented in Spanish, and any misleading promises are strictly prohibited. Additionally, the Mexico labeling/marking requirements be sure that labels are legible, indelible, and placed where They may be conveniently noticeable to The patron. These procedures type A part of the obligatory criteria of labeling demands in Mexico and are enforced by authorities like PROFECO and COFEPRIS.
Mexico's governing administration necessities for labeling are notably demanding when it comes to imported products. Imported food stuff and beverage solutions have to comply with Mexican NOM labeling for meals, including adapting the packaging to include the appropriate warnings, nutritional panels, together with other applicable information according to the Mexican Formal Common NOM-051-SCFI/SSA1-2010. This normally involves relabeling goods or implementing stickers for NOM-051 compliance just before they are allowed for sale. These kinds of labels have to not obscure the original solution labeling and should give all needed particulars in Spanish. The Mexican Formal typical NOM-051-SCFI/SSA1-2010 mandates obvious, legible, and truthful details. Products have to not use terms like “pure” or “healthful” Unless of course they satisfy strict criteria. The Mexico foods legislation also restricts marketing features on packaging that include one or more warning labels. These measures discourage deceptive statements and really encourage food items providers to reformulate their items to stay away from labeling penalties. Therefore, some firms have diminished sugar, salt, and Extra fat in their recipes to fall down below the thresholds that result in entrance-of-bundle warnings.
